> > Went out to the nature center today to give the K20D a workout with
> > my A400/5.6 and A2X-S converter. This combination wasn't really
> > working with the K10D or the *istD. Because the wide open stop is
> > f11, I had to go to at least ISO 800, even though I was working off
> > the tripod. Too much noise. The same was true for handholding the
> > A400/5.6 without the converter. One of the reasons I wanted the K20D
> > was to be able to use this lens and lens/converter combo efficiently.
> > Some preliminary samples follow. All were with High ISO noise
> > reduction set to weak.

> > In brief, due to reduced noise at high ISO, the new camera is giving
> > me long-glass capability that I didn't have with any of the other
> > Pentax digitals.
